  4. Gasoline prices in African countries 2025

    Consumers in Central African Republic paid the highest price for gasoline in Africa as of April 2025. One liter of the fuel cost on average 1.9 U.S. dollars in the country. In Senegal, the retail price for gasoline octane-95 reached on average 1.71 U.S. dollars per liter, the second-highest on the continent. On the other hand, consumers living in traditional crude oil producers in Africa, such as Nigeria, Algeria, Angola, Libya, and Egypt spent less money on gasoline. For instance, one liter cost 0.03 U.S. dollar in Libya, among the cheapest in the world.

    East Africa Petroleum Product Industry Report

    The East African petroleum product industry, encompassing Uganda, Kenya, Tanzania, Mozambique, and the Rest of East Africa, presents a dynamic and expanding market. Driven by robust economic growth, increasing urbanization, and rising vehicle ownership across the region, the industry is projected to experience a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) exceeding 3.50% from 2025 to 2033. Significant demand is observed across all petroleum product segments—light distillates (gasoline and naphtha), middle distillates (diesel and kerosene), and heavy distillates (fuel oil and bitumen). Growth is fueled by infrastructure development projects, industrial expansion, and a burgeoning agricultural sector requiring energy for mechanization and processing. However, the industry faces challenges, including price volatility tied to global crude oil prices, infrastructural limitations hindering efficient distribution, and environmental concerns related to emissions. To mitigate these restraints, investments in refining capacity, pipeline infrastructure, and cleaner fuel technologies are crucial. The presence of established international players like TotalEnergies SE, Shell PLC, and Exxon Mobil Corporation, alongside regional operators such as KenolKobil Ltd and National Oil Ethiopia PLC, indicates a competitive yet developing market landscape. This competition, alongside government policies promoting energy security and diversification, will shape the future of the East African petroleum product sector. The market segmentation reveals varying growth rates across different countries within East Africa. While precise figures for each country's market share are unavailable, Kenya and Tanzania are likely to dominate due to their larger economies and higher vehicle density. Uganda and Mozambique also show promising growth potential, fueled by infrastructure development initiatives and increasing industrialization. The "Rest of East Africa" segment, encompassing smaller nations, likely contributes a smaller portion but still presents opportunities for specialized players catering to local demands. The industry is expected to see a steady increase in the demand for cleaner fuels and a growing interest in renewable energy sources, influencing the future trajectory of the market. This shift creates opportunities for investment in renewable energy infrastructure alongside sustainable petroleum product refining and distribution. Recent developments include: In September 2021, Tullow Oil and its partners in the Turkana oil project in Kenya announced that they have significantly increased their resource and production estimates following a reassessment of the delayed Kenyan oil development project. The oil project, located in the South Lokichar basin in northern Kenya, will now have a production plateau of 120,000 barrels/day (b/d)., In December 2020, Ethiopia's Ministry of Mines and Petroleum announced that it has opened 22 mining and 5 petroleum sites as well as 3 service areas for investors in the country. Identified petroleum potential sites are in Ogaden, Gambella, South Omo, and Rift Valley.. Notable trends are: Middle Distillates to Dominate the Market.

    East Africa Downstream Oil and Gas Industry Report

    The East African downstream oil and gas industry, encompassing refineries, petrochemical plants, and distribution networks across Mozambique, South Sudan, Kenya, and the rest of the region, presents a dynamic and expanding market. Driven by increasing energy demand fueled by population growth, urbanization, and industrialization, the market is projected to experience robust growth, with a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) exceeding 2.32% from 2025 to 2033. Key players such as China National Petroleum Corporation, Eni SpA, and Royal Dutch Shell PLC are actively investing in infrastructure development and expansion, reflecting the significant potential of the sector. However, challenges remain, including infrastructure limitations in some areas, geopolitical instability in certain regions, and fluctuating global oil prices which can impact investment decisions and profitability. The segment breakdown shows varied growth trajectories across countries; Kenya and Mozambique, due to their relatively stable political climate and expanding economies, likely demonstrate higher growth rates compared to South Sudan which faces ongoing challenges. The industry's future hinges on sustained economic growth, government policies promoting investment, and successful mitigation of geopolitical and infrastructural risks. Further analysis suggests that the market's size in 2025 is estimated to be around $10 billion based on similar developing economies and industry reports. This value is projected to grow steadily, reflecting the CAGR of 2.32% and market forces. The segmentation data indicates that refineries and petrochemical plants will likely drive much of the market growth, with the contribution from each segment varying by country. While challenges such as volatile oil prices and infrastructure limitations exist, the long-term outlook for the East African downstream oil and gas industry remains positive. Strategic investments in infrastructure modernization, regional cooperation, and diversification of energy sources will be crucial to unlocking the region's full potential and ensuring sustainable growth in the sector. Recent developments include: In December 2022, Savannah Energy declared the acquisition of producing oil fields in South Sudan from Malaysian state oil and gas company Petronas. The investment is valued at USD 1.25 billion. The other partners include the international energy company, the China National Petroleum Corporation, India's flagship energy major, the Oil and Natural Gas Corporation, and South Sudan's national oil and gas company, Nilepet.. Notable trends are: Refinery Capacity to Witness growth.

    Uganda Petroleum Products Market Report

    The Ugandan petroleum products market, valued at approximately $XX million in 2025, is projected to experience robust growth with a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) exceeding 3.10%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is fueled by several key drivers. The increasing urbanization and motorization within Uganda are significantly boosting fuel demand across transportation, residential, and commercial sectors. Furthermore, growth in the fishing industry and expanding industrial activities contribute to the heightened consumption of petroleum products like gasoline, diesel, and kerosene. While the market faces restraints such as price volatility linked to global crude oil prices and potential environmental concerns regarding emissions, the overall positive growth trajectory is expected to continue. The market is segmented by fuel type (gasoline, diesel, jet fuel, kerosene, liquefied petroleum gas) and end-user (transport, residential, commercial, fishery, others). Major players like Vivo Energy Uganda Ltd, TotalEnergies SE, and Nile Energy Limited dominate the landscape, competing through varied distribution networks and product offerings. The forecast period anticipates continued market expansion, driven by infrastructure development and sustained economic growth in Uganda. The ongoing diversification of fuel sources and adoption of cleaner energy alternatives, while not significantly hindering growth, will influence market dynamics in the longer term. The diverse end-user segments present opportunities for targeted marketing strategies. The transport sector will remain the largest consumer of petroleum products, given the growing number of vehicles on Ugandan roads. However, the residential and commercial sectors are also expected to witness considerable growth in demand, aligning with the country’s economic expansion and development projects. The relatively untapped potential of the fishing industry presents a niche area for growth, with a focus on providing fuel solutions tailored to the specific needs of this sector. Competition among market players will likely intensify, focusing on pricing strategies, distribution network expansion, and the introduction of value-added services to cater to the growing and evolving demands of the Ugandan market. Recent developments include: In August 2021, Uganda planned to revive oil product imports via Tanzania to reduce its reliance on supply routes through Kenya. The country wants to omit disruption to the supply chain due to the 2022 general election in Kenya.. Notable trends are: Diesel as a Significant Petroleum Product.
